Output 3ecffb02357516d415fa784058f26f58725e4e84b33ac88e7db6166b62549166: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f30e35de3b705a32cdd35571e88694a3d72595f OP_EQUAL
address
3K7wYzUEt9qzMaQktSJRCtAVoJXj8CRfLv
transaction
3ecffb02357516d415fa784058f26f58725e4e84b33ac88e7db6166b62549166
confirmations
299699
spent
true